Edin Dzeko begs Manchester City to sign him
today at 11:21 am
The likelihood of much desired Bosnian striker Edin Dzeko signing for Manchester City has vastly increased after it was revealed that he wrote to the club asking them to sign him.
Come and get me pleas are ten a penny in the world of tabloid transfer speculation, when even the slightest reference from a player to a particular club will result in a frenzy of headlines suggesting that said player is desperate to join.
This particular story seems to have some merit, however, as it has been revealed that Dzeko, who plays for Wolfsburg in the Bundesliga, sent a letter to a senior executive at Eastlands earlier in the season, expressing his admiration for the club and his gratitude for their efforts to buy him in the August window.
City’s initial efforts to sign Dzeko were thwarted by Wolfsburg’s asking price, thought to be in the region of £45 million (€53 million), but City have continued to monitor the 24-year old’s progress and their desire for a top class striker will have increased in the wake of Carlos Tevez’s public expression of his desire to leave the club.
City invited Dzeko’s representatives to watch the recent Manchester derby and gave them a tour of their training facilities, with the club eager to make an impression on a player who is coveted by some of the top clubs in Europe.
Dzeko has continued his fine form from recent seasons in this campaign with eight goals in 15 games for Steve McLaren’s Wolfsburg. At 6’3”, he is a significant aerial threat and his arrival would pave the way for the departure of Emmanuel Adebayor, who has sulked his way through this season, the vast majority of which he has spent on the bench.
Dzeko has appeared 31 times for the Bosnian national side, scoring 17 goals.
